Computer >> Máy Tính >  >> Hệ thống >> Windows

Cách xuất danh sách Dịch vụ Windows bằng dòng lệnh

Bạn có thể sử dụng Command Prompt hoặc lệnh ghép ngắn Get-Service PowerShell t0 để tạo danh sách các Dịch vụ Windows Đang chạy hoặc Đã dừng. Bài đăng này sẽ chỉ cho bạn cách bạn có thể tạo danh sách các Dịch vụ Windows đang chạy trên máy tính Windows 11/10/8/7 của mình.

Cách xuất danh sách Dịch vụ Windows

Xuất danh sách Dịch vụ Windows bằng dòng lệnh trong CMD

Mở Command Prompt nâng cao, nhập nội dung sau và nhấn Enter:

sc query type= service > "%userprofile%\Desktop\ServicesList.txt"

Thao tác này sẽ lưu danh sách dưới dạng tệp văn bản trên Màn hình của bạn.

Sử dụng PowerShell để tạo danh sách Dịch vụ Windows

Nhận dịch vụ cmdlet được thiết kế để truy xuất thông tin về các dịch vụ được cài đặt trên máy tính của bạn. Sử dụng lệnh ghép ngắn Get-Service PowerShell, bạn có thể tạo danh sách các Dịch vụ Windows đang chạy trên máy tính Windows 10/8/7 của mình.

Cách xuất danh sách Dịch vụ Windows bằng dòng lệnh

Mở bảng điều khiển PowerShell nâng cao, nhập Nhận dịch vụ và nhấn Enter. Bạn sẽ thấy danh sách tất cả các Dịch vụ được cài đặt trên hệ thống Windows của mình.

Bạn cũng có thể lọc ra kết quả bằng khả năng lọc của Windows PowerShell. Sử dụng các tham số để đạt được điều này. Bạn có thể tạo danh sách Dịch vụ đang chạy cũng như Dịch vụ đã dừng . Bạn cũng có thể sắp xếp chúng theo tên bằng cách sử dụng Sắp xếp-Đối tượng cmdlet. Bạn có thể tiến thêm một bước và thậm chí xuất danh sách ra GridView .

Ví dụ:bạn có thể sử dụng Get-Service lệnh ghép ngắn, lọc trạng thái trên từ Đang chạy, sau đó xuất ra GridView , bằng cách sử dụng lệnh sau:

Get-Service | Where Status -eq "Running" | Out-GridView

Thao tác này sẽ tạo ra một danh sách các Dịch vụ đang chạy và một cửa sổ khác sẽ mở ra để hiển thị kết quả.

Để truy xuất thông tin về Dịch vụ đã dừng trên máy tính từ xa và xuất thông tin đó ra GridView, hãy sử dụng -ComputerName tham số, như được hiển thị bên dưới:

Get-Service -ComputerName RemoteComputerName | Where Status -eq "Stopped" | Out-GridView

Để xuất danh sách các Dịch vụ Windows, hãy sử dụng lệnh sau:

Get-Service | Where-Object {$_.Status -eq "Running"} | Out-File -filepath "$Env:userprofile\Desktop\ServicesList.txt"

Thao tác này sẽ lưu danh sách dưới dạng tệp văn bản trên Máy tính để bàn của bạn.

Đây chỉ là ba ví dụ. Đọc thêm về Nhận dịch vụ trên TechNet.

Bây giờ, hãy xem cách Xuất và Sao lưu Trình điều khiển Thiết bị trong Windows bằng PowerShell.

Sử dụng Windows PowerShell, bạn cũng có thể cập nhật các định nghĩa của Bộ bảo vệ Windows, liệt kê Ổ đĩa, gỡ cài đặt ứng dụng Phổ thông, tìm trạng thái xếp hàng đợi các tác vụ đã lên lịch, tạo Hình ảnh hệ thống, tạo lối tắt trên màn hình để mở ứng dụng Windows Store, nhận danh sách Trình điều khiển đã cài đặt, xuất Trình điều khiển, v.v. !

Cách xuất danh sách Dịch vụ Windows bằng dòng lệnh